**Ticket PARITY-412: Kestrel SDK catch-up**

Quick one for the weekly sync: the Kestrel-Go SDK is still missing batched uploads and retry hints that Kestrel-JS shipped two releases ago. Partner teams keep asking. Plan is to land both behind a flag this sprint and cut a minor release. Needs a sign-off from the owner named below.

account owner for bajef-badup: Drueth Kelath Pelael Holwyn

### Changelog — Broker Upgrade + Key Rotation

Hey, welcome to the Murkwell team! Quick context: we upgraded the Pellstone message broker from 4.2 to 5.0 last sprint, which changed how nodes authenticate to the cluster. The old shared-secret scheme is gone; brokers now verify signed deploy manifests instead. As part of the cutover we rotated everything — old keys are dead, don't use anything from the archived wiki. All broker deploys from here on must be signed with the current key, which is:

release key, kajep-kawep: bky6_6NQiA4

### Meeting notes — DocLint rollout (excerpt)

- Linter (Scribewell) now blocks merges on broken internal links and missing classification headers.
- Security ask: confirm linter cannot execute embedded snippets; parser is static-only, verified in review.
- Rule updates go through signed config bundle; no runtime fetch.
- Open item: audit trail for suppressed warnings, due next sprint.
- Escalation owner for the audit item is noted below.

named custodian: Belius Casath Ulaix Sorius

## Per-tenant rate quotas — Corvasse API gateway

This fragment covers how quota enforcement is wired for review purposes. Each tenant gets a token bucket keyed by account tier; buckets refill on a fixed interval and overflow requests receive a retry hint rather than a hard drop. Quota state lives in the shared cache cluster and is not persisted across failovers, which is accepted risk per the Larkspur assessment. For audit purposes, the enforcement parameters currently deployed are shown below.

deployment values, yadug-bawif:
[framir]
team = pelox
access_code = ac_a38ab2
owner = tamion.julael
host = framir.tolvaqlabs.test
port = 11211
peer = tammir.zemvargrid.local
salt = 2215ef03
pin = 1541